Top 10 Best Fat Burning Exercises

 Top 10 Best Fat Burning Exercise 


  1. High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) - a type of cardio workout that alternates between high-intensity intervals and low-intensity recovery periods.
  2. Burpees - a full-body exercise that involves a squat, jump, and pushup.
  3. Jumping Jacks - a simple yet effective cardio exercise that engages many muscles, including the legs, arms, and core.
  4. Running - a classic cardio exercise that can be done outside or on a treadmill.

  6. Cycling - another low-impact cardio exercise that can be done indoors or outdoors.
  7. Rowing - a low-impact cardio exercise that works the upper body, lower body, and core.
  8. Swimming - a low-impact exercise that works the entire body and can be a good option for those with joint pain.
  9. Boxing - a high-intensity workout that can burn a lot of calories and engage many muscle groups.

  10. Circuit Training - a type of workout that involves performing several exercises back-to-back with little rest in between.
  11. Strength Training - building muscle through weight training can boost metabolism and help burn fat over time.

Top 5 Best Back Workout For Woman

A strong and well-developed back is essential for overall strength, posture, and aesthetics. Here are five effective back exercises for women Full Video Guide Back Workout For Woman 👇🏻 1. Lat Pulldowns:  This exercise targets the latissimus dorsi, the largest muscle in the back. Sit at a lat pulldown machine, grasp the bar with a wide grip, and pull it down towards your chest while keeping your back straight. Slowly return to the starting position and repeat for the desired number of repetitions. 2. Bent-Over Rows:  Bent-over rows work the upper and middle back muscles, including the rhomboids and trapezius.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, hinge forward at the hips, and hold a dumbbell in each hand with your palms facing inward. Pull the dumbbells towards your torso, squeezing your shoulder blades together. Lower the weights and repeat. 3. Woman Full Body Workout At GYM

  A full-body workout is an excellent way to target all major muscle groups and improve overall fitness. Here's a sample workout plan for women that you can do at the gym: Warm-up: Start with 5-10 minutes of cardio, such as jogging on the treadmill or using the elliptical machine, to get your heart rate up and loosen up your muscles. Squats: Begin with 3 sets of 10-12 reps of squats. To do a squat, st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, then bend your knees and lower your hips until your thighs are parallel to the floor. Make sure to keep your back straight and your knees behind your toes. Lunges: Follow up squats with 3 sets of 10-12 reps of lunges. To do a lunge, step forward with one foot and lower your hips until both knees are bent at a 90-degree angle. Then, push off your front foot and return to the starting position.
